Heather Thursday at 10:32 PM Share Thursday at 10:32 PM (edited) Abby! It depends on the work you do, I suppose. I'm not doing HDR as of now. Most jobs are TVCs viewed on the internet. Although, I recently did a documentary and my set up was fine. I use a Flanders DM240 (older HD model, but I get it calibrated every 6 months and its a work horse.) Mac Studio Pro, UltraStudio HD Mini, Louper for remote grading. I have a tiny set up, but it works for me:) Edited Thursday at 10:37 PM by Heather Link to comment Share on other sites
